Earthwork grading services involve shaping and leveling the ground to prepare a property for construction, landscaping, or drainage improvements. This process typically includes removing excess soil, filling in low spots, and creating a smooth, even surface. Proper grading ensures that water flows away from structures and prevents pooling or flooding issues, which can be critical for the longevity and safety of a property.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ment to perform precise grading that meets the specific needs of each project, whether for residential yards, commercial sites, or larger developments.
One of the primary problems that earthwork grading helps address is poor drainage, which can lead to water accumulation, erosion, or foundation damage. Incorrectly graded land may cause water to collect around structures, resulting in potential water intrusion or structural instability. Proper grading also helps prevent soil erosion by establishing a stable surface that directs water flow efficiently. Additionally, grading can improve the usability of outdoor spaces, making slopes safer and more accessible for landscaping, pathways, or recreational areas.

Labor Costs - Labor expenses for earthwork grading typically range from $50 to $150 per hour, depending on project complexity and local rates. For a small residential project, labor might total around $1,000, while larger jobs can reach several thousand dollars.
Equipment Fees - Equipment rental costs, including bulldozers and graders, usually fall between $200 and $500 per day. The total equipment costs depend on project size and duration, with larger projects incurring higher rental fees.
Material Expenses - Costs for materials such as fill dirt or gravel generally range from $10 to $50 per ton. Material quantities and types influence overall expenses, which can add several hundred to thousands of dollars to the project.
Permits and Fees - Local permitting costs for earthwork grading services typically range from $50 to $300, depending on jurisdiction and project scope. These fees are necessary for legal compliance and vary by location.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
